Understanding the Tea Poker Tell

In poker, a “tell” is a change in a player’s behavior or demeanor that gives clues about their hand. While common tells include physical gestures or facial expressions, the concept of a “tea poker tell” introduces a subtler layer to the psychological game. Observant players might notice how their opponents handle their tea—a sip, a stir, or a pause can sometimes reveal nervousness or confidence. These seemingly insignificant actions can offer valuable insights into a player’s mindset and intentions.

The Role of Calm Habits in Poker

Maintaining composure at the poker table is crucial, and calm habits can significantly enhance a player’s focus and decision-making. Drinking tea, often associated with tranquility and relaxation, might be a deliberate tactic for players aiming to project calmness and control. By creating a serene personal environment, players can better manage stress and maintain a clear mind, which is essential for strategic thinking and quick reflexes.

What is 'The Tea Tell' in poker?

The Tea Tell refers to using tea as a tool to help maintain calmness and focus during poker games.

How can drinking tea benefit poker players?

Tea can provide a calming effect and improve concentration, which are essential for making strategic decisions in poker.

Which type of tea is most commonly used by poker players for focus?

Green tea is often favored due to its moderate caffeine content and L-theanine, which can enhance focus without causing jitters.

Are there specific times when poker players should drink tea?

Poker players often drink tea before or during games to maintain a steady level of focus and calmness throughout the session.

Can drinking too much tea negatively impact poker performance?

Yes, excessive tea consumption can lead to overstimulation or frequent bathroom breaks, which can distract from the game.
